DESCRIPTION OF WORK

As an Application Developer 2, you will provide application development services in support of middleware applications. You will serve as a technical and business team member, cross-functional project resource, or lead worker for the systems development life cycle (SDLC) management of these mission critical applications used to support various Program Offices within the Delivery Center. As you develop your knowledge of our delivery center, you will provide mentoring to other technical staff. You can expect to use platforms and systems such as Visual Studio, BizTalk, Azure, and file transfer systems.

QUALIFICATIONS Minimum Experience and Training Requirements: Four years of information technology experience that includes two years of experience in applications development or applications maintenance; or One year as an Applications Developer 1 or Computer Programmer 3; or Two years of information technology experience in applications development or applications maintenance, and an associate's degree in any information technology field; or A bachelor's degree in any information technology field. Applicants will be considered to have met the educational requirements once they are within 3 months of graduating with a qualifying degree.

EXAMINATION INFORMATION

Completing the application, including all supplemental questions, serves as your exam for this position.  No additional exam is required at a test center (also referred to as a written exam). Your score is based on the detailed information you provide on your application and in response to the supplemental questions. Your score is valid for this specific posting only. You must provide complete and accurate information or: your score may be lower than deserved. you may be disqualified. You may only apply/test once for this posting.
